Between all the cards, wrapping paper, old decorations and unwanted presents, the UK produces an alarming amount of waste every Christmas. In fact, a recent survey by Biffa found that we create 30% more waste than usual over the festive period, including a billion cards and almost a quarter of a million miles of wrapping paper. Like all industries, food and drinks producers have a responsibility to make sure their products and manufacturing processes inflict as little damage to the environment as possible. One company leading the way in this regard is Carlsberg, and earlier this month the Danish beer producers revealed two fully recyclable research prototypes made from sustainably sourced wood fibres.
